Real-World Impact: Effects on People, Industry, Society

The impact is multifaceted - for residents living near flood-prone areas it means evacuation orders may be issued forcing them to leave their homes temporarily. Schools often close as a precautionary measure; businesses experience closures or disruptions due to road blockages and power outages.

In terms of economic activities like tourism which rely heavily on these regions, they have faced significant setbacks affecting not only visitors but also local economies dependent on hospitality services including food vendors who find it hard in unanticipated wet climates.

The social impact is especially dire; families having their houses washed away risk losing everything, while the health sector faces challenges as clean water and sanitation are compromised during emergencies.
